Birthday gift questionnaire
Birthday gifts go wrong when the giver is working from an old mental model — the wine they liked in college, the hobby they dropped, the size from three years ago. A short questionnaire refreshes the picture without making the recipient plan their own party gift.
When to send it
Two to three weeks before the date is ideal. Day-of asks feel like you forgot; month-early asks get lost. A single link or printed half-page is enough.
Questions to copy and paste
- Any allergies, dietary limits, or scents to avoid?
- Clothing or shoe size (if wearables are in play)?
- What are you into right now — hobbies, shows, collections?
- What do you reach for every week but never replace?
- Favorite snacks, drinks, or coffee order at the moment?
- Anything you do not want more of (clutter, candles, mugs)?
- Experience or item — which would you enjoy more this year?
- Two gift ideas under $___ that you would actually use?
- Anything you admire but would not buy for yourself?
- Best way to reach you if the giver has a quick follow-up?
